Mary Dixon Ellis was born of Nov. 17, 1929. She was only 16 years old when she married C.P. Ellis on October 29, 1945, in Randolph County. Despite C.P. Ellis owning a small service station the two still struggled to escape from poverty. The couple would go on to have four children.

They had one son who they called Punkin’. He was blind, deaf, and intellectually challenged which led to more financial hardships. Mary Ellis didn’t support C.P.’s involvement with the Klan. “She didn’t particularly like the Klan,” said C.P., “but she endured it because I enjoyed it, see?” It is believed that after the charette, Mary took C.P.’s rifle he used for Klan duties and buried it in the backyard, making sure it was never to be retrieved again. Mary Ellis died on October 22, 1999, at the age of 69. She is buried in Durham County, NC.
